- Clean, restore, and deodorize contents and property affected by fire, water, mold, smoke, or sewage.
 - Capture “before-and-after” photos of items cleaned for documentation and client reassurance.
 - Assist in content assessments and restoration planning.
 - Keep clients informed about your work, addressing questions and concerns professionally.
 - Report safety issues or unusual findings to supervisors promptly.
 - Communicate clearly with clients, managers, crew chiefs, and technicians throughout each job.
 - Learn—and follow—proper water, smoke, and mold-removal methods and equipment usage (we’ll train you!).
 - Help maintain our workspace by performing light office cleaning tasks as needed.
